#bbc4e5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#bbc4e5 is composed of 73.3% red, 76.9% green and 89.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.3% cyan, 14.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 227.1 degrees, a saturation of 44.7% and a lightness of 81.6%. #bbc4e5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#7789cb.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#bbc4e5 color description : Light grayish blue.

#bbc4e5 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#bbc4e5 has RGB values of R:187, G:196, B:229 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0.14, Y:0,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 12305637.

Shades and Tints of #bbc4e5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010203 is the darkest color, while #f4f5f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#bbc4e5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#cdced3 is the less saturated color, while #a2b6fe is the most saturated one.
